T. Cook’s at The Royal Palms Resort, Phoenix Offers Outdoor Dining Year Round

February 9, 2009| By:Mackenzie Allison

Royal Palms ResortIf the weather is nice, why spend time indoors? The AAA Four-Diamond Royal Palm Resort & Spa in Arizona seems to share the same sentiment and is now offering year-round outdoor dining at their restaurant, T. Cook's. This Southwestern gem has two patios-- one with picture-perfect vistas of the Vernadero Lawn to the south, and the northern patio gazes out on Camelback Mountain. Even warm-weather states have chilly moments, and T. Cook's has it covered with a heated floor for chillier months. The eatery also boasts ceiling fans, a misting system and awnings to protect from Arizona's notorious "dry heat." I can't wait to check out the fireplace, which is said to fill the air with the fragrance of mesquite and pinon.
